ANEK Lines, Minoan Lines and Superfast all have daily services from Ancona to Patra and the ships will be quiet in May - you will be able to book a ticket before joining the ship. All have modern ships of a similar standard, so there's not much to choose between them. I've always preferred Minoan Lines, but I'd happily travel with the others. If you are staying on Poros, there's no need to book tickets in advance as there are plenty of ferries and fast craft - it's best to buy a ticket at Pireas for the next departure rather than be committed to a particular sailing in advance.

From Galatas to Poros, there are small launches that cross frequently on demand till late in the evening, but the small car ferry runs less frequently. The road to Galatas is a minor mountain road and most traffic goes on the ferries from Pireas. I don't know where to find the times for the Galatas ferry, but if you're booking a hotel in Poros, they should be able to get details for you.
